Launch pillars
A premium discovery layer for every major paintball job to be done.
The website launches as a national field finder, events hub, newsroom, and gear intelligence product that shares one coherent search and content system.
Field Finder
State-first browse, amenity signals, trusted details, and correction workflows.
Events Hub
League pages, event detail pages, date filters, and venue context built for planning.
Newsroom
Editorial coverage and AI-assisted draft workflows with human review in the loop.
Gear + Deals
Structured product pages, offer snapshots, comparisons, and commerce-aware discovery.
